Dylan:
I like all the bright colours in this book and enjoy touching the pages with the animals on, especially the sea horse. But my favourite bit is the big pop out spider at the end! I like their big eyes and the way their legs move up and down.
Mum and Dad:
Dylan has enjoyed reading this book with us a few times now. He’s drawn to the colourful cover so often picks it out to read and look at. It is good for learning some of the parts of animals although Dylan is a bit young to pick up on some of the more subtle ones. It’s fairly long as these type of books go, so his attention does wane sometimes. He’s always drawn back in by the pop-up surprise at the end though!
